BioForce Nanosciences, Inc. Receives Second Half of a $400,000 National Institutes of Health (NIH) Grant

AMES, Iowa--(BUSINESS WIRE)--BioForce Nanosciences,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of BioForce Nanosciences Holdings, Inc. (OTCBB:BFNH), announced today the receipt of the second year of funding under a National Institutes of Health (NIH) Small Business Innovation Research (SBIR) grant for nearly $200,000, furthering its Emerging Technologies program. This brings the total funding under the grant to $400,000. The funding will be used to construct and evaluate a nanobiosensor capable of detecting protein biomarkers from just a few cells. The proposed nanobiosensor, with the tradename Chip-on-a-Tip™, opens the door to fast and informative analysis of minute protein samples such as those studied in forensics or biopsy microsamples.
